The Georgetown Volunteer Fire Company was called to a car crash on Redding's Mountain Road on November 19. A delivery truck toppled in a residential driveway during the event. While EMS assessed the driver and discharged him on the spot, firefighters looked for any dangers. Engine 31, Rescue 34, and Ambulance 117-4 operated, and the scene was cleared once the vehicle was secured.
